The origin of the phrase can be traced to the 1700s, in recent years the meaning if the phrase has changed from negative (you make my eyes hurt) to positive (you make my sore eyes feel better.) Something that is beautiful to look at.

A sight for sore eyes translates into the sight of you makes my eyes all better, and means that you like looking at that sight. ClichΓ© someone or something that one is excited or overjoyed to see, often after a long absence or separation. Definition of 'a sight for sore eyes'.
